Quantitative Analysis of Micro Skyline Based on Fractal Theory and Power Law Distribution
The micro skyline is an important component of urban landscapes and holds significance in urban planning and design.Taking Zhengzhou city as an example,the fractal characteristics of the micro-skyline and the power-law distribution of related building heights are studied by using the fractal theory and the power-law distribution method.The results of the study provide a strong theoretical support for the in-depth understanding of the morphological characteristics and distribution law of the micro skyline,and deepen the understanding of the complexity of the city skyline,while also providing a certain reference for urban planning and design.
